Does Revolut Work In Vietnam?

Revolut is available for use in Vietnam, allowing users to spend in Vietnamese Dong and make ATM withdrawals. The service includes a multi-currency card that can be used for transactions in Vietnam, making it convenient for travelers and residents alike.

However, there are some limitations to be aware of. Currency exchange fees may apply, and ATM withdrawals are subject to fair-usage fees depending on the user's plan. Additionally, some ATMs may charge extra fees that Revolut cannot control. Users should always opt out of ATM currency conversion to avoid unexpected charges.

Fees and Charges for Using Revolut in Vietnam

When using Revolut in Vietnam, there are several fees and charges to be aware of:

  • Currency exchange fees: Subject to fair-usage limits and weekend markups.
  • ATM withdrawal fees: Free up to certain limits based on the user's plan; beyond these limits, a 2% fee or a minimum fee of £1 applies.
  • Transaction fees: No specific transaction fees for spending in Vietnamese Dong, but currency exchange fees may apply if the transaction involves a currency conversion.
  • Withdrawal limits: Fee-free ATM withdrawals up to £200 for Standard and Plus plans, £400 for Premium plan, and £800 for Metal plan.
  • Additional ATM fees: Some ATMs may charge an extra access fee that Revolut cannot control.
  • Currency conversion at ATMs: Users should select 'No' if an ATM asks to convert money to avoid unfavorable exchange rates.

Frequently Asked Questions about Revolut in Vietnam

Can I use Revolut to pay in Vietnamese Dong?

Yes, Revolut allows you to spend in Vietnamese Dong using its multi-currency card.

Are there any fees for ATM withdrawals in Vietnam?

ATM withdrawals are free up to certain limits; beyond that, a 2% fee applies.

Does Revolut charge for currency exchange in Vietnam?

Currency exchange fees may apply, especially during weekends and beyond fair-usage limits.

Is Revolut widely accepted in Vietnam?

Revolut is accepted at most places that take Visa or Mastercard in Vietnam.

Can I avoid ATM currency conversion fees with Revolut?

Yes, always select 'No' when an ATM asks to convert money to avoid extra fees.
